Kentucky Derby Just Nudges Out Super Bowl for Most Traffic

By just under 700 unique visitors, the Kentucky Derby has become the most inquired about betting event covered on the Gambling911.com website, it was revealed Sunday following a record breaking traffic day - the biggest in Gambling911.com's eight year history.  The amount of traffic was more than double that of a typical Saturday. 

"The most amazing thing for us about the Kentucky Derby is how nearly everyone coming onto the site is looking to place bets," commented Payton O'Brien, Senior Editor of the G911 website.   "It goes without saying our sponsors probably got their money's worth in just a few hours."

Gambling911.com is traditionally the most visible of the news sites covering the Kentucky Derby betting odds angle, but it was not without its competition.  Unlike in past years, websites like Point-Spreads.com, Online Gambling Paper, Sports-Odds.com and OnlineSportsHandicapper.com enjoyed grand visibility throughout the day. 

"Considering the intensive competition, these numbers are epic!" exclaimed O'Brien.  "It would not surprise us if the Derby performed just as well in terms of betting action as the Super Bowl at those companies like BetUS.com and Sportsbook.com that really market the Kentucky Derby heavily."

Therein lies the problem.  Of all the online gambling websites out there, maybe only half really offer a significant Kentucky Derby betting menu.  Others simply do not market the Derby as prolifically as say the Super Bowl or March Madness.

Next up: The Preakness, which does not encompass the same amount of interest as the Kentucky Derby but is still an important betting event nonetheless.
